Polish forest berry prices hit record highs in 2026

Wild forest berries are selling at unusually high prices across Poland in 2026. On the Łódź Wholesale Market the price per kilogram ranges from 40 zł to 50 zł, while the Kalisk Market lists about 45 zł per kilogram. In Poznań a three‑kilogram box costs 120‑140 zł (roughly 40‑47 zł/kg). Retail prices are even higher: Wrocław’s Hall sells a kilogram for 59 zł, and the Mirowska Hall in Warsaw reaches similar levels. Regional variations persist – a litre of berries costs 20‑30 zł in places such as Zambrow, Ząbki, Gdańsk, Mazovia, Silesia, Lubusz and Podlasie. Sellers warn that the season is drawing to a close, urging buyers to act before fresh berries disappear. The surge is driven by strong demand despite a modest harvest caused by a cool spring, keeping market prices at record levels.
